A driver in Calabogie was rescued from a partially submerged vehicle by quick thinking neighbours and emergency responders.
On Tuesday, November 28th, local emergency crews were called out after police were advised that a dump truck lost control and rolled into the marsh on Barryvale Road.
Reports say that nearby neighbour entered the water and located the driver. It was determined that the driver was trapped, and they were attempting to cut the seatbelt.
Once on scene, officers jumped into the water to join the rescue and the driver was safety recovered.
The driver and responding officers were transported to a local hospital.
